The Science of Hair Growth: Hair growth is a fascinating aspect of hair mechanics that involves understanding the hair growth cycle, factors influencing hair growth rate, and mechanisms of hair loss. The hair growth cycle consists of three main phases – anagen (growth phase), catagen (transitional phase), and telogen (resting phase) – each playing a crucial role in determining the length and thickness of the hair shaft. By studying the science of hair growth, professionals can recommend personalized treatments and products to support healthy hair growth and address conditions like alopecia and balding.
Additionally, advancements in hair mechanics have led to the development of innovative treatments such as laser therapy, scalp micropigmentation, and hair transplants, offering solutions for individuals experiencing hair loss and seeking to restore fullness and confidence.
